Do optometrists near Lodge, SC accept Medicaid or Medicare?

Many optometry practices in the surrounding South Carolina Lowcountry regions do accept Medicaid (Healthy Connections) and Medicare. However, coverage specifics for eye exams and glasses can vary. It is crucial to call the optometrist's office directly—whether in Walterboro, Bamberg, or elsewhere—to confirm they are currently accepting new patients with your specific plan. Be sure to ask what services are covered under your plan's vision benefits versus medical benefits (e.g., a medical eye problem may be covered differently).

How far in advance do I typically need to book an eye exam with an optometrist near Lodge, SC?

Appointment availability can vary. For a routine eye exam with a popular practice in a nearby town like Walterboro, you might need to schedule 2-4 weeks in advance, especially at the beginning or end of the year when insurance benefits renew. For more urgent concerns (like sudden vision changes or eye injuries), most offices will try to accommodate same-day or next-day appointments. It's recommended to call early in the day for urgent slots. Establishing care with a local optometrist can also lead to easier scheduling for future annual exams.
